Understanding the Mechanics of Real-Time Bidding

Real-time bidding operates within milliseconds through a sophisticated network of demand-side platforms (DSPs), supply-side platforms (SSPs), and ad exchanges. When a user visits a website, their browser sends a request to the publisher’s ad server, initiating the auction process. This sequence occurs before the webpage fully loads, ensuring minimal impact on user experience.

The core functionality relies on open real-time bidding protocols that facilitate transparent communication between buyers and sellers. Advertisers set bids based on predefined criteria such as demographic data, geographic location, and behavioral patterns. Publishers receive competitive offers from multiple bidders, selecting the highest-value impression to display.

  • Auction Process: The entire transaction happens in less than 100 milliseconds, requiring robust infrastructure to handle massive volumes of requests simultaneously.
  • Bidirectional Communication: Real-time bidding systems enable continuous feedback loops, allowing advertisers to refine targeting parameters dynamically during campaign execution.
  • Ad Exchange Role: Acting as intermediaries, ad exchanges aggregate inventory from various sources, enabling efficient matching between available ad space and interested buyers.

Critical Components Driving Effective RTB Campaigns

SUCCESSFUL implementation hinges on three fundamental pillars: accurate data collection, intelligent bid management algorithms, and seamless integration with existing advertising ecosystems. These interdependent elements form the backbone of efficient programmatic operations.

Data quality remains paramount in determining campaign effectiveness. High-resolution datasets encompassing user demographics, browsing history, and psychographic information empower precise segmentation and targeting capabilities.

  • User Profiling: Comprehensive user profiles enable contextual relevance, increasing click-through rates by up to 30% compared to generic approaches.
  • Demand-Side Platforms: Sophisticated DSPs utilize machine learning models to predict optimal bid prices, minimizing wasted spend on low-conversion opportunities.
  • Supply-Side Optimization: Publishers benefit from yield management tools that maximize revenue by prioritizing high-value buyer relationships.

Navigating Common Challenges in Real-Time Bidding

Despite its advantages, real-time bidding presents unique obstacles that require careful navigation. Issues ranging from ad fraud detection to latency concerns necessitate proactive mitigation strategies to maintain campaign integrity.

The prevalence of bot traffic poses significant risks, potentially inflating costs and skewing performance metrics. Implementing advanced verification technologies helps identify and filter out non-human activity before it impacts campaign results.

  • Fraud Detection Systems: Employing AI-powered solutions capable of detecting suspicious patterns in bid behaviors enhances security measures effectively.
  • Latency Management: Optimizing network infrastructures reduces response times, crucial for securing winning bids in highly contested markets.
  • Data Privacy Compliance: Adhering to evolving regulations like GDPR ensures ethical handling of personal information while maintaining operational efficiency.

Advanced Optimization Strategies for RTB Success

Maximizing ROI requires adopting innovative tactics beyond conventional practices. Leveraging predictive analytics and A/B testing methodologies allows for continual refinement of bidding strategies based on empirical evidence rather than assumptions.

Dynamic creative optimization represents another frontier in enhancing campaign performance. By automatically adjusting creatives based on real-time responses, advertisers can achieve better engagement levels and improved brand recall among target audiences.

  • Predictive Modeling: Utilizing historical data sets to forecast potential outcomes informs smarter decision-making when setting bid thresholds.
  • Geotargeting Enhancements: Fine-grained geographical segmentation enables localized messaging that resonates more strongly with regional preferences.
  • Frequency Capping: Limiting exposure frequency prevents ad fatigue while maintaining consistent visibility across desired channels.
